WorldCon, the World Science Fiction Convention, is kind of a big deal for the Shadow Family. Not just because we’re big fans of the genre (Shadow Jack and I met in an internet chat room devoted to SF), but because it’s held in a different location every year and it gives us an excuse to travel a bit. It’s also a big deal for me because I am in love with the Masquerade.
Masquerade one of the big events at every WorldCon. It’s primarily a costume contest, but most entrants also perform a skit of some sort. The workmanship on many of the costumes is astonishing, particularly in the Master category (this site displays some of the costumes from the last several conventions, although the photos aren’t large enough to show some of the more intricate details).
When we attended the 2005 convention in Glasgow, Shadaughter and I decided to participate in the Masquerade. This worked out well for us because I like to make costumes and she’s a big ol’ ham. She was a cheerleader in high school at the time,* and she was also a big fan of Buffy the Vampire Slayer,** so she requested a Vampire Cheerleader costume.
We won in the Best Presentation category, and to our delight her performance turned up on YouTube a few months after the convention. So if you’ve ever wondered what a vampire would cheer about, here you go:
